Ordinals
beta
Sat 882509033144595
decimal
176501.4033144595
degree
0°176501′1109″4033144595‴
percentile
42.024239719778826%
name
hpfcpkthmlq
cycle
0
epoch
0
period
87
block
176501
offset
4033144595
timestamp
2012-04-20 20:35:18 UTC
rarity
common
prev
next